Goals and Descriptions |
| |
|
PS1: PHYSICAL FITNESS
The learner will be able to
achieve and maintain a health-enhancing level of physical fitness.
|
PS2: PHYSICALLY ACTIVE LIFESTYLE
The learner will be able to
exhibit a physically active lifestyle.
|
|
ллл |
PE.5.2.1 Fitness Assessment
The learner will be able to
participate in fitness assessment (i.e.. FITNESSGRAM or Presidential) and developmentally appropriate health-related fitness activities for the purpose of improving skill performance and physical fitness.
|
|
ллл |
PE.5.2.2 Health-Related Fitness Standard
The learner will be able to
demonstrate progress toward meeting health-related fitness standards as defined by research.
|
|
ллл |
PE.5.2.3 Interpret Fitness Test
The learner will be able to
interpret the results and significance of information provided by formal measures of physical fitness (FITNESSGRAM or Presidential).
|
|
лл |
PE.5.2.4 Health-Related Fitness Activities
The learner will be able to
select and participate in appropriate activities to improve personal fitness levels.
|
|
л |
PE.5.2.5 Health Benefits
The learner will be able to
describe the health benefits that result from regular and appropriate participation in physical activity.
|
PS3: MOVEMENT PROFICIENCY
The learner will be able to
demonstrate competency in many movement forms and proficiency in a few movement forms.
|
PS4: MOVEMENT CONCEPTS AND PRINCIPLES
The learner will be able to
apply movement concepts and principles to the learning and development of motor skills.
|
|
л |
PE.5.4.1 Mature Movement Patterns
The learner will be able to
demonstrate mature performance of all basic skills: locomotor skills, nonlocomotor skills, manipulatives, transfer of weight, spatial awareness, and relationships.
|
|
ллл |
PE.5.4.2 Advanced Skills
The learner will be able to
demonstrate competency in more advanced specialized skills and transfers appropriately from one to another.
|
|
лл |
PE.5.4.3 Skill Transition
The learner will be able to
recognize similarities and differences between movement skills and transfers appropriately from one to the other.
|
|
ллл |
PE.5.4.4 Rhythmic/Aerobic Skills
The learner will be able to
create complex rhythmic and aerobic routines.
|
PS5: PERSONAL RESPONSIBILITY
The learner will be able to
demonstrate responsible personal and social behavior in physical activity settings.
|
PS6: RESPECT
The learner will be able to
demonstrate understanding and respect for differences among people in physical activity settings.
|
|
лл |
PE.5.6.1 Personal and Social Responsibility
The learner will be able to
demonstrate responsible personal and social behavior in physical activity settings.
Learner participates in establishing rules, procedures, and etiquette that are safe and effective for specific activities.
